Can I transfer credits from other courses towards Level 5 Advanced Diploma in Computing and Information Technology (fast-track)?

Yes, you may be able to transfer credits from other courses towards the Level 5 Advanced Diploma in Computing and Information Technology (fast-track) program. This can help you save time and money by not having to retake courses you have already completed.

Transferring credits is a common practice in higher education, allowing students to apply previous coursework towards their current program. However, the process and requirements for transferring credits can vary depending on the institution and the specific courses you have taken.

Before transferring credits, it is important to check with the institution offering the Level 5 Advanced Diploma in Computing and Information Technology (fast-track) program to see if they accept transfer credits and what their specific requirements are. Some common requirements for transferring credits include:

Requirement Description
Accreditation The institution where you completed the previous courses must be accredited and recognized by the institution offering the Level 5 Advanced Diploma program.
Grade You may be required to have earned a minimum grade in the courses you wish to transfer, such as a C or higher.
Relevance The courses you have taken must be relevant to the program you are transferring credits towards. For example, courses in computer programming may be more likely to transfer to a computing and information technology program.

By meeting these requirements and providing the necessary documentation, you may be able to transfer credits towards the Level 5 Advanced Diploma in Computing and Information Technology (fast-track) program.
